Just came off a great weekend in Tacoma! I was honored by a gathering of friends and new friends on Friday, Feb. 3, 2012 at Immanuel Presbyterian Church in Tacoma, WA, where I read parts of ON BEING A GAY PARENT, and facilitated a discussion.
What made this a special visit was the eventful passing of marriage equality by the WA State Senate, and now the House this week, and soon the signing of the bill into law by the Governor. There is an expected drive to put it on the ballot next Nov., 2012 (a pastor is against marriage equality). Here I was from NC, in which the General Assembly voted to put forth an amendment against marriage equality.
Love will win out.
